Posted by Gold_12TH on Mon Jul 23 21:39:45 2012 Traffic was snarled on Richmond Avenue today while the city Department of Transportation painted the right lane red between Arthur Kill and Forest Hill road. The Staten Island Mall-bound lane was painted red to make way for a Select Bus Service (SBS) route. The route runs down Richmond Avenue from the Staten Island Mall to Hylan Boulevard, up the East Shore and into Brooklyn at 4th Avenue and 86th Street. The MTA plans to convert the S79 into the SBS route with fewer stops and designated bus lanes, such as the lane currently being painted. The S59 will continue to provide local bus stops on Richmond Avenue and the S78 will still make local stops on Hylan Boulevard, but the S79, when the SBS begins in September according to an MTA report, will offer an more efficient route that will save commuters about 15 minutes in their commutes one way. |
